Gasoline Prices Fall In Maine But Downward Trend Might Be Brief

GasBuddy.com

Gasoline prices in Maine have fallen about 6 cents a gallon over the last month, and now stand at a statewide average of $2.48.

Gas Buddy analyst Patrick DeHahn says prices are not expected to drop much more in the near future. "Well, gas prices may remain relatively stable around where they are today at $2.48 a gallon," he says. "I'm not seeing any tremendous downward moves."

Over the past year, gas prices in Maine have risen by about 20 cents a gallon, and DeHahn says oil prices are close to being the highest than they've been since 2015.

Nationally, gas prices fell last week to $2.45, on average.  Compared to last month, that's just over 11 cents per gallon lower, but it's about 24 cents per gallon higher than a year ago.
